The court extended the house arrest of the director of the singer Linda Kuvshinov.
The Tverskoy Court of Moscow, at the request of the investigation, extended the house arrest of the director of the singer Linda (real name Svetlana Gaiman) until August 20 Mikhail Kuvshinov, who is accused of fraud with the rights to the musical works of producer Maxim Fadeev. This was reported on June 19 by a correspondent of Izvestia.
Fadeev was recognized as a victim, and the material damage is estimated at over 1 million rubles. Kuvshinov's lawyer had previously said that Fadeev had no complaints against his client. According to him, the producer considers him to be the same victim — this was stated during the confrontation.
Kuvshinov was placed under house arrest on May 14 until June 20. He did not admit his guilt. The investigation considered that if a milder measure was imposed, Linda's director could hide, influence the course of the investigation, and also put pressure on witnesses and victims. According to Izvestia, the criminal case is related to the case of Andrey Cherkasov, CEO of the Jam music publishing house, who is in jail. The Cherkasov-owned office of Profit LLC was searched on May 12. They are connected with the detention of singer Linda. Cherkasov is charged with two counts of fraud, it was noted on May 13. Later, the defendant was also charged with an article on the illegal formation of a legal entity.
